post-construction cleaning seasonality in Hendersonville: a month-by-month calendar
post-construction cleaning demand in Hendersonville runs through the year rather than in one season; temperatures peak in July (average high 83°F) and bottom out in January (average low 27°F), so weather affects scheduling more than demand. The figures below are NOAA 1991-2020 monthly normals for ASHEVILLE 13 S, about 8 miles from Hendersonville; read them with the Hendersonville market page, the post-construction cleaning industry page, smart scheduling and the AI receptionist in mind.
Demand for post-construction cleaning in Hendersonville is spread across the year, so weather affects scheduling and routing more than it affects whether the work exists.
Across the whole year, Hendersonville's average high peaks at 83°F in July and its average low bottoms out at 27°F in January; precipitation is highest in July (5.3 inches) and lowest in October (3.5 inches).
Seasonality changes staffing and cash flow more than it changes whether the work exists. Planning capacity around the busy months, and using the quieter ones for recurring-service sign-ups and follow-up, is the standard way post-construction cleaning businesses smooth the year.
- January: 48°F high / 27°F low, 4.4 in of precipitation, 2.9 in of snow
- February: 51°F high / 29°F low, 3.6 in of precipitation, 0.6 in of snow
- March: 58°F high / 35°F low, 4.0 in of precipitation, 1.0 in of snow
- April: 67°F high / 42°F low, 4.3 in of precipitation
- May: 74°F high / 51°F low, 4.2 in of precipitation
- June: 80°F high / 59°F low, 4.8 in of precipitation
- July: 83°F high / 63°F low, 5.3 in of precipitation
- August: 82°F high / 62°F low, 4.7 in of precipitation
- September: 77°F high / 56°F low, 4.4 in of precipitation
- October: 68°F high / 44°F low, 3.5 in of precipitation
- November: 58°F high / 34°F low, 3.9 in of precipitation
- December: 50°F high / 30°F low, 4.4 in of precipitation, 2.1 in of snow

How does the system synchronize with construction timelines?+
Builder milestones are entered into the system and linked to your cleaning phases. When a builder notifies you that drywall is complete, the rough cleaning phase is triggered and scheduling begins. The system accepts timeline updates from builders via email, portal, or direct communication with your team, adjusting your cleaning schedule automatically. This real-time synchronization eliminates the common problem of crews arriving to a site that is not ready or missing a deadline because the construction schedule shifted without your knowledge.
Can I track builder satisfaction and relationship health?+
Yes. After each completed project, the system sends a brief satisfaction survey to the builder contact. Scores are tracked over time, showing whether relationship health is improving or declining. Combined with project volume trends, this data gives you early warning when a builder may be considering other providers. Regular satisfaction data also helps you identify what builders value most so you can emphasize those qualities in your service delivery and marketing.
